Diabetes Educator - Diabetes at Providence St. Mary Medical Center, Walla Walla, WA
$5,000 hiring bonus for eligible external hires that meet required qualifications and conditions for payment.
The Clinical Dietitian works closely with the interdisciplinary health care team to provide patient focused nutrition services and medical nutrition therapy that are integrated and compatible with the patient's medical program goals and objectives. Primary responsibilities include developing and implementing nutrition services and medical nutrition therapy using established standards of care and practice protocols/guidelines; assuring customer needs and satisfaction are met and/or exceeded; managing resources in a cost effective manner; participating in performance improvement efforts; and maintaining professional competency and skills required for professional practice.
Required qualifications:
* Bachelor's Degree Dietetics, Food and Nutrition, or related area granted by U.S. regionally accredited college or university.
* Coursework/Training: Completion of a didactic program in dietetics and supervised practice program approved by the Commission of Dietetic Registration (CDR), the credentialing agency for the Academy of Nutrition & Dietetics.
* Required within 6 months (180 days) of hire: Washington Dietitian Certification Or
* Required within 6 months (180 days) of hire: Washington Nutritionist Certification
* Required upon hire: National CDR Registered Dietitian - Commission on Dietetic Registration
Preferred qualifications:
* 3 years Clinical/related experience and/or master's degree in related field.
* Preferred upon hire: Certified Specialist in related field (CLE, CDE, CNSD, CS)
